Quality Manager Lab - Semiconductor Materials - Cairo, OH


DESCRIPTION:

The Quality Manager-Lab will oversee laboratory personnel and activities, provide technical guidance and operational support to develop, maintain and improve laboratories, and associated processes for the for the plant. Candidate will deliver on multiple priorities in support of the Quality and Operations Teams and business functions and will support efforts to maintain compliance with ISO14001, Quality ISO9001 and other corporate-sponsored initiatives.


R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Provide laboratory resources in support of internal and customer needs and expectations at all Plants.
  • Manage and optimize all Commercial laboratory operations
  • Ensure laboratory and personnel performance meets the needs and expectations set by the company and customers including, not limited to, processes, procedures, cleanliness, calibration, compliance to internal and external requirements, maintenance and sustainability of laboratory equipment, support of plant operations and quality.
  • Establish and maintain laboratory equipment and instrumentation and contracts with vendors and service providers.
  • Responsible for budgetary and expenses pertaining to all laboratory equipment, supplies, maintenance and repair. CapEx submission for laboratory related proposals as well as documentation relating to all budgetary and expense related items.
  • Drive the accurate and timely installation of new laboratory equipment in relevant labs and support installation of new equipment in operations that have a direct impact on laboratory analysis (e.g. in line sampling ports and meters, particle counters)· Evaluate new technology, improved capabilities, for the industries we serve, customer needs and expectations and continual monitoring and measurement devices and methodologies. This includes, new and existing equipment, designs and construction.
  • Support investigations pertaining to internal and external non-conformances and opportunities for improvement.
  • Support of Quality and Responsible Care including, not limited to ISO, internal and customer.· Effectively interact with plant personnel and cross-functional resources to understand and interpret manufacturing and laboratory data to drive continuous improvement.
  • Provide input and communicate output for site with specific laboratory related information.· Ensure consistency of methodology, equipment, processes, work instructions, forms, inventory and all related laboratory items across plants where possible and appropriate.
  • Evaluate the performance of lab equipment, solutions and methodology as well as action items pertaining to resolving non-performance issues.
  • Support internal and customer communication and collaboration representing UPA laboratories and analytical matters.
  • Responsible for the performance and documentation of laboratory reliability and repeatability testing and validation of methods on a continual basis. This includes, not limited to, GR&R, method and design development, validation and studies, standard operating procedures, troubleshooting guides.
  • Oversee change management and action items pertaining to laboratory and in support of quality and operations.
  • Support operations and quality for each site including providing resources, evaluating the needs of the plant, support of planned and unplanned operational events, troubleshooting and customer related issue or requests.
  • Review and validate data on an on-going basis to make data driven decisions, evaluate trends and determine action plans and/or opportunities for improvement. Provide both internal and external reports/documentation as required.
  • Provide laboratory support for Quality Engineers in the review of Statistical Process/Quality Control (SPC/SQC), MRB/DRB as needed.
  • Utilize and apply basic data-analysis tools such as SPC and Pareto Charts in review of laboratory data to drive process and/or continual improvement activities with laboratory personnel. Work with lab technicians in review quality of lab data input and accuracy.
  • Support Failure Mode and Effect Analysis (FMEA) events and related actions as well as other continual improvement projects (e.g. Roadmaps, Green Belt Projects, and Mapping)· Other duties assigned by Quality Manager


BACKGROUND PROFILE:

  • Minimum of a Bachelor’s degree in chemistry or science related field.
  • Minimum 5 years’ experience in quality systems
  • Minimum 3 years’ management experience in a laboratory environment.
  • Knowledge on an ICP-MS, clean rooms, and wet chemical lab procedures.
  • Root Cause Analysis Training and Experience· Working knowledge of Applied Statistics including the use of statistical tools and techniques· Strong leadership, interpersonal and communication skills· Experience in Project Management
  • Ability to train, motivate, coach and work with others
  • Strong presentation skills
  • Demonstrated experience in change management and leading change· Customer focus including the ability to clearly communicate both oral and written
  • Demonstrated values of honesty and integrity, respect for others, teamwork, collaboration, accountability and performance.
  • Excellent analytical and problem solving skills (group facilitation, conflict resolution) and the ability to handle multiple projects simultaneously while working in a fast-paced environment.
